The Rochester Museum & Science Center (RMSC) is a cornerstone of education and discovery in the Finger Lakes region, offering three floors of interactive exhibits that explore science, technology, natural history, and the cultural heritage of the Genesee Valley. Located at 657 East Avenue, the RMSC campus includes the main Museum & Science Center, the iconic Strasenburgh Planetarium, and the 900-acre Cumming Nature Center in Naples, NY.
Highlights include the Expedition Earth gallery with a life-size mastodon skeleton, the At the Western Door exhibit exploring Haudenosaunee (Iroquois) culture, and rotating special exhibitions that bring cutting-edge science to life. The Strasenburgh Planetarium features immersive star shows and laser light experiences under its 65-foot dome — one of the largest planetarium domes in the Northeast.
The RMSC is a top destination for school field trips, family outings, and curious adults alike. With regular programming including Science Saturdays, adult-only After Dark events, and summer camps, there's always something new to discover. The museum's commitment to making science accessible and fun has made it a Rochester institution for over 100 years.
